Transaction 24ef88f8df99ca67717fe6ddc9031497a953bd45e6424a5c686af03b60a0e54d
1 Input
1 Output
-
24ef88f8df99ca67717fe6ddc9031497a953bd45e6424a5c686af03b60a0e54d:0
- value
- 4708746
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d3dfbb42d38248ca59b8920af350b0e0296b4699 OP_EQUAL
- address
- 3M1JXA26JCw1HaxL7Cs6R4vJiknLan5Uyz